4.5.2 Start screen and self-test
Immediately after switching on, the display shows the start screen for
a few seconds. Subsequently, the furnace conducts an automatic self-
test. The performance of all furnace components is automatically
checked.
The following information is displayed:
Information
Self-test
Automatic self-test in progress. The furnace is checking the function
of the furnace components.
The self-test was successful. No malfunctions were found.
The self-test was not successful. Please note the error message on the
display.
Temperature calibration
Temperature calibration of the furnace is not required.
Some time has passed since the last calibration. Please conduct a
calibration procedure.
Power supply
The power supply voltage is in the acceptable range.
The power supply is outside the acceptable range.
Software version The currently installed software version is displayed.
If the self-test has been successful, the furnace will automatically display the home screen.
If the program recognizes a malfunction during the test, a corresponding error
message with the corresponding rectification information appears on the display.
The acoustic signal and the error message can be acknowledged with the
corresponding buttons.
Press the [Next] button to confirm the self-test.
Before the first firing, the firing chamber should be dehumidified using the dehumidification program
(see Chapter 5.3 for details).
Please note that the furnace may require a certain acclimation time after it has been set-up. Particularly if the
furnace was exposed to considerable temperature differences (water condensation).
